How to fill out the Nebraska Form 1040n V 2014 online

Filling out the Nebraska Form 1040n V 2014 online is a straightforward process that allows you to submit your individual income tax payment voucher efficiently. This guide provides clear instructions on how to complete the form and ensure your payment is correctly processed.

Follow the steps to fill out your Nebraska Form 1040n V 2014 online

  1. Click the 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it for editing.
  2. Enter your first name and initial in the designated fields. Ensure that the entries are printed clearly or typed for legibility.
  3. If filing a joint return, enter your spouse's first name and initial as well.
  4. Fill in your last name in the appropriate section.
  5. Provide your current mailing address, including the number and street or PO Box, city, state, and zip code.
  6. Input your Social Security number and, if applicable, your spouse’s Social Security number.
  7. Enter your daytime phone number to facilitate any necessary communication.
  8. Indicate the total amount you are remitting. Please ensure this amount matches your calculations.
  9. Consider using e-pay as an alternative to mailing a check. Ensure you check the relevant option on the form.
  10. After reviewing all entries for accuracy, save your changes. You can choose to download, print, or share the completed form as needed.

Form 1040NR is a version of the IRS income tax return that nonresident aliens may have to file if they engaged in business in the United States during the tax year or otherwise earned income from U.S. sources throughout the year.

Residents must report all income to Nebraska, and will receive a credit for taxes paid to other states by completing Form 1040N and Nebraska Schedule I. Nonresidents and partial-year residents must file a Form 1040N and a Nebraska Schedule I to compute the Nebraska tax due. ... You must file a Form 1040N.

The Nebraska Form W-4N was developed due to significant differences between the federal and Nebraska laws regarding standard deductions and because personal exemptions credits are allowed on the Nebraska return. ... Complete Form W-4N so your employer can withhold the correct Nebraska income tax from your pay.

If you file form 1040 (U.S. resident return), you must report, and are subject to taxation on your worldwide income. Non-Residents, who file form 1040NR, must only report their US sourced income.
